Ramadan: Pray, Work For Unity, Peace Of Oyo State, Nigeria – Seyi Makinde

Oyo State Governor-elect, Engineer Seyi Makinde on Monday charged Muslim faithful in Oyo State and Nigeria to work and pray for the progress of the state and the country.

The governor-elect gave the charge in a release signed by his spokesman, Prince Dotun Oyelade made available to journalists in Ibadan

He emphasized that the unabated kidnapping, insecurity and rising unemployment in the country deserve our collective efforts to salvage the country from the precipice of virtual peril.

According to the governor-elect, ” hard work and prayers are the only way out of this untold dilemma in which we have found ourselves.”
